Output 84faae573da8664e4428de0dfa8818cbcab2f12ded83dc1593a69dd92f270d84:116

value
77730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d79c4c74965f3e1cb3a8b7cd99c8f2b1137b2b18 OP_EQUAL
address
3MM4ScE6cfyFmoU2KD7Z63isMEKVKSfW57
transaction
84faae573da8664e4428de0dfa8818cbcab2f12ded83dc1593a69dd92f270d84
spent
true